About 589 people live here, median age 36. Median household income is $72,143, near the U.S. median near $78,000. Home values center near $186,800, an affordability ratio of 2.7× — accessible. Rent burden reaches 3% of tenant households. Vacancy runs 5.4%. DLRadar's demographic-stress index for the area reads 20/100. Owners hold 75% of homes, renters 25%. There are about 247 housing units across 68958. 3.8% of residents fall below the poverty threshold. Educational attainment sits at 31% bachelor's-or-above.
